To reach Tholos do Monge, you'll typically travel to Sintra first. From Lisbon, take a train from Rossio Station to Sintra (approx. 40 minutes). Once in Sintra, you can hike or take a bus towards the Sintra-Cascais Natural Park. Many visitors explore the park on foot, so comfortable shoes are a must. Reddit

While there are roads within the Sintra-Cascais Natural Park, parking directly at Tholos do Monge might be limited. It's often recommended to park in Sintra town and explore the park via hiking trails or local transport. Instagram

Tholos do Monge is located within the Sintra-Cascais Natural Park, which is largely open access. You do not need a ticket to visit the monument itself, though access to other attractions within the park may require admission fees. Instagram

As an ancient monument within a natural park, Tholos do Monge does not have set opening or closing hours. It is accessible during daylight hours when you can safely navigate the trails. Instagram

The Sintra-Cascais Natural Park itself is free to enter and explore. However, specific palaces, castles, and attractions within the park, such as Pena Palace or Quinta da Regaleira, have their own admission fees. Reddit

For popular Sintra attractions like Pena Palace or Quinta da Regaleira, booking tickets in advance online is highly recommended to avoid long queues, especially during peak season. Reddit

There are no specific restrictions for visiting Tholos do Monge, but it's important to respect the historical site and the natural environment. Stick to marked trails and do not disturb the monument. Instagram

The History and Significance of Tholos do Monge

The Tholos do Monge is a significant megalithic tomb dating back over 2300 years, making it a fascinating glimpse into prehistoric settlements in the region. Its name, 'Tholos,' refers to the beehive-shaped structure characteristic of such tombs. Located at one of the highest points in the Serra de Sintra, it was once a prominent landmark, though it has been largely overlooked for decades, often overshadowed by the nearby Geodetic Marker. Reddit

Historically, this site was a burial ground, reflecting the ancient funerary practices of the people who inhabited this area. The monument's presence at such an elevated location suggests strategic or ritualistic importance. Recent efforts have focused on its requalification and cleaning, aiming to preserve this piece of history for future generations. Informative plaques have been installed to educate visitors about its past. Reddit
